Telecommunications jobs in Greenwood, Nova Scotia, Canada

Apply for Telecommunications Jobs in Greenwood, Nova Scotia, Canada, Alsolist provided a complete list of Telecommunications Jobs offers in Greenwood, Nova Scotia, Canada.